Parametry | Specyfikacja |
Prąd jazdy | 40~70A |
Napięcie jazdy | Nie więcej niż 5V |
Częstotliwość rozładowania | Nie więcej niż 5 Hz |
Tryb zasilania | DC 18V-36V |
Tryb wyzwalania | Wewnętrzny/zewnętrzny wyzwalacz |
Interfejs zewnętrzny | Optoizolator, wyzwalacz zbocza narastającego |
Szerokość impulsu (wyładowanie elektryczne) | 1ms~4ms |
Rosnąca/opadająca krawędź | ≤15us |
Aktualna stabilność | ≤5% |
Kontrola jazdy | RS485 |
Temperatura przechowywania | -55~85°C |
Temperatura robocza | -40~+65°C |
Wymiar (mm) | 70*38*28 |
1) Opis
1 | Wejście zasilania 24 V |
2 | Połącz się z laserami |
3 | Interfejs sterowania |
2) Definicja
SZPILKA |
|
|
1 | SG+ | Zewnętrzny wyzwalacz+ |
2 | SG- | Zewnętrzny wyzwalacz- |
3 | RS+ | RS485+ |
4 | RS- | RS485- |
5 | GND | RS485GND |
1)USART: RS-485
2) Szybkość transmisji: 115200bps
3) Od: 8 bitów daty (bit startu, bit stopu, bez parzystości)
4) Najmniej znaczący bajt jest przesyłany jako pierwszy (lsb)
5)Format wiadomości:
Nagłówek (1 bajt) |
Wiadomość |
Koniec (1 bajt, suma kontrolna) |
Tabela1: Opis nagłówka
Nazwa bajtu | Typ bajtu | Długość w bajtach | wartości | Notatka. |
Zacznij kodować | bajt bez znaku | 1 | 0xAA | Stały |
Tabela 2: Opis końca (suma kontrolna)
Nazwa bajtu | Typ bajtu | Długość w bajtach | wartości | Notatka. |
Suma kontrolna | bajt bez znaku | 1 | 0-255 | Całkowita liczba bajtów (nagłówek i koniec) podzielona przez 256, z uwzględnieniem przypomnienia. |
1) Wyjście danych
Główny panel sterowania wysyła rozkazy na dysk macierzy.Zlecenie zawiera 5 bajtów, które składają się z 3 bajtów wiadomości (bajty wiadomości można dodawać lub usuwać)
Tabela 3: Wyjście danych
Zamówienie | Bajt1 | Bajt2 | Bajt3 | Notatka. |
Stan wyzwalacza wewnętrznego/zewnętrznego |
0X01 |
0X00=zewnętrzny wyzwalacz 0X01=wewnętrzny wyzwalacz |
0X01 | Zwykle używany jest wyzwalacz zewnętrzny Do debugowania można używać wewnętrznych wyzwalaczy |
Ustawienie prądu wyjściowego |
0X02 |
0X00 |
Aktualny | Zakres: 40 ~ 70A rozmiar kroku1A |
Ustawienie szerokości impulsu wyjściowego | 0X03 | Szerokość impulsu wysokiego bajtu | Niskobajtowa szerokość impulsu | Zakres: 1000 ~ 4000us rozmiar kroku: 1 us |
zegar wewnętrzny | 0X04 | 0X00 | Częstotliwość |
|
Zapisywanie danych LD | 0X09 | 0X00 | 0X01 |
|
Wyjście LD start/stop |
0X07 | 0X00=zatrzymaj 0X01=start |
0X01 |
2)Wprowadzanie danych
Napęd macierzy wysyła komunikaty do głównego panelu sterowania.
Opóźnienie odpowiedzi: 1000 ms.W czasie opóźnienia odpowiedzi, jeśli główny panel sterowania nie odbiera komunikatów z dysku macierzy, musi wystąpić błąd.Wiadomość zawiera 5 bajtów, które składają się z 3 bajtów wiadomości
Tabela 4: Wprowadzanie danych
Zamówienie | Bajt1 | Bajt2 | Bajt3 |
Stan wyzwalacza wewnętrznego/zewnętrznego |
0X01 | 0X00=zewnętrzny wyzwalacz 0X01=wewnętrzny wyzwalacz |
0X01 |
Ustawienie prądu wyjściowego | 0X02 | 0X00 | Aktualny |
Ustawienie szerokości impulsu wyjściowego | 0X03 | Szerokość impulsu wysokiego bajtu | Niskobajtowa szerokość impulsu |
Zegar wewnętrzny | 0X04 | 0X00 | Częstotliwość |
Zapisywanie danych LD | 0X09 | 0X00 | 0X01 |
Samoadaptacyjne napięcie LD | 0X05 | 0×00 | 0×00 |
Wyjście LD start/stop |
0X07 | 0X00=zatrzymaj 0X01=start |
0X01 |
Błąd przetężenia LD | 0X0A | 0X00 | 0X01 |
Nadmiar napięcia ładowania | 0X0B | 0X00 | 0X01 |